Lucy E. Dalton is a scholar working on Cell Biology, Molecular Biology and Epidemiology.
According to data from OpenAlex, Lucy E. Dalton has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 422 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Cell Biology, 8 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Lucy E. Dalton’s work include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(10 papers), RNA regulation and disease (5 papers) and Autophagy in Disease and Therapy (3 papers). Lucy E. Dalton is often cited by papers focused on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Disease (10 papers), RNA regulation and disease (5 papers) and Autophagy in Disease and Therapy (3 papers). Lucy E. Dalton coll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Italy and Canada. Lucy E. Dalton's co-authors include Stefan J. Marciniak, Elke Malzer, Sally E. Thomas, David A. Lomas and James A. Irving and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Scientific Reports and Journal of Cell Science.
